About the Role
As a Data Platform Engineer, you'll work alongside senior team members to tackle complex challenges, while taking ownership of your own areas of the problem, in a fast-paced environment where no two days look the same. The role is fundamentally about problem solving: understanding business challenges, breaking them down, and delivering pragmatic, scalable solutions.You’ll work closely with product, analytics, and engineering teams, operating with a high degree of autonomy. That means proactively gathering context, aligning stakeholders, and ensuring work lands effectively.Data Platform sits at the centre of the business, with a real opportunity to shape how teams interact with data.
The focus is on enabling fast, iterative analytics, moving from idea to insight quickly, while maintaining strong foundations around reliability, cost, and security.Our Modern Tech StackYou’ll work across a broad set of technologies as we evolve the platform.
